[发明专利]一种业务事件的处理方法、装置、系统及存储介质在审
| 申请号: | 202110771580.4 | 申请日: | 2021-07-08 |
| 公开(公告)号: | CN113391927A | 公开(公告)日: | 2021-09-14 |
| 发明(设计)人: | 张振兵;孙海英;唐俊军;刘乐;宋龙飞;李蒙蒙 | 申请(专利权)人: | 上海浦东发展银行股份有限公司 |
| 主分类号: | G06F9/50 | 分类号: | G06F9/50;G06F9/54 |
| 代理公司: | 北京品源专利代理有限公司 11332 | 代理人: | 赵迎迎 |
| 地址: | 200000 *** | 国省代码: | 上海;31 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 业务 事件 处理 方法 装置 系统 存储 介质 | ||
1.一种业务事件的处理方法,其特征在于,所述方法包括:
通过当前队列控制器根据当前事件队列的使用率和所述当前事件队列对业务事件的存储速率,确定所述当前事件队列是否能够接收新的业务事件;
若能够,则将所述新的业务事件存储到所述当前事件队列中;
通过所述当前线程池控制器对当前事件处理线程进行调整,并根据该调整结果为所述当前事件队列中的业务事件分配当前事件处理线程;
通过所分配的当前事件处理线程对业务事件进行处理,得到业务请求结果;其中,所述当前队列控制器、所述当前事件队列、所述当前线程池控制器和所述当前事件处理线程均属于当前业务处理模块。
2.根据权利要求1所述的方法,其特征在于,所述通过所述当前线程池控制器对当前事件处理线程进行调整,包括:
通过所述当前队列控制器统计所述业务事件在所述当前事件队列中的停留时间,若所述停留时间超过预设时间,则向当前线程池控制器发送通知消息,以使所述当前线程池控制器增加所述当前事件处理线程的数量;其中,所述当前线程池控制器属于当前业务处理模块。
3.根据权利要求1所述的方法,其特征在于,所述通过所述当前线程池控制器对当前事件处理线程进行调整,包括:
通过当前线程池控制器根据所述当前事件处理线程的使用率、所述当前事件队列中业务事件的数量,对所述当前事件处理线程的数量进行调整。
4.根据权利要求1所述的方法,其特征在于,还包括:
通过所述当前队列控制器根据当前应答队列的使用率和当前应答队列对业务事件的存储速率,确定所述当前应答队列是否能够接收新的业务事件;
若能够,则将所述新的业务事件存储到所述当前应答队列中;
通过所述当前线程池控制器对当前应答线程进行调整,并根据该调整结果为所述当前应答队列中的业务事件分配当前应答线程;
通过所分配的当前应答线程对业务事件进行处理,得到业务应答结果;
通过当前超时控制器记录所述业务事件从存储到所述当前事件队列中到得到业务应答结果之间的时间间隔;若所述时间间隔大于预设时间,则向请求发起方返回系统繁忙通知报文;其中,所述当前应答队列、所述当前应答线程和所述当前超时控制器均属于当前业务处理模块。
5.根据权利要求1所述的方法,其特征在于,还包括:
通过下一业务处理模块中的下一路由器,将所述业务请求结果作为业务事件发给下一业务处理模块中的下一事件队列,由下一业务处理模块进行处理。
6.根据权利要求1所述的方法,其特征在于,所述方法包括:
若当前业务处理模块为执行业务事件接入的模块,则通过所述服务接入控制器控制所述服务接入模块获取所述业务事件的数量;
若当前业务处理模块为执行业务事件接出的模块,则通过所述服务接出控制器控制所述服务接出模块接出所述业务事件的数量。
7.根据权利要求1所述的方法,其特征在于,所述将所述新的业务事件存储到所述当前事件队列中,包括:
根据所述业务事件的标识号,确定所述业务事件的事件属性,并将所述业务事件存储到该事件属性对应的事件队列中。
8.一种业务事件的处理装置,其特征在于,所述装置包括:
确定模块,用于通过当前队列控制器根据当前事件队列的使用率和所述当前事件队列对业务事件的存储速率,确定所述当前事件队列是否能够接收新的业务事件;
存储模块,用于若能够,则将所述新的业务事件存储到所述当前事件队列中;
分配模块,用于通过所述当前线程池控制器对当前事件处理线程进行调整,并根据该调整结果为所述当前事件队列中的业务事件分配当前事件处理线程;
处理模块,用于通过所分配的当前事件处理线程对业务事件进行处理,得到业务请求结果;其中,所述当前队列控制器、所述当前事件队列、所述当前线程池控制器和所述当前事件处理线程均属于当前业务处理模块。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于上海浦东发展银行股份有限公司,未经上海浦东发展银行股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202110771580.4/1.html,转载请声明来源钻瓜专利网。





